Sony launches it’s own version of XNA
It sounds weird, but Sony is coming out with a similar idea as the XNA only giving it an own twist. Northwest Vision and Media have set up a project named ‘Get in the Game’ which will offer five developers the change to receive GBP 10,000 to prototype new content for the PlayStation Network.
At a workshop in December visitors will be able to bring their idea’s to a panel of Sony execs and producers. Then five of those will be given 10,000 pounds to bring their idea to live in the first three months of 2009.
These prototypes will then be shown to SCEE who will decide if they will bring any of them into production in effort to support the games industry in the Northwest region of Great Britain.

This is really closer to the Microsoft Dream Build Play competition and not like XNA at all.
There is no distribution mechanism like Community Games, there is no API and there’s no special dev environment.
It really just a way for indies to pitch a game
